📖 Definitions of "Bring"
verb
- 1
(ditransitive) To transport toward somebody/somewhere.
"Waiter, please bring me a single malt whiskey."
- 2
To supply or contribute.
"The new company director brought a fresh perspective on sales and marketing."
- 3
To occasion or bring about.
"The controversial TV broadcast brought a storm of complaints."
- 4
To raise (a lawsuit, charges, etc.) against somebody.
